They use custom Amfisound guitars, Antti has a custom Routa called the "Atrain", if I recall correctly he has a Dimebucker in the bridge position and a Seymour Duncan Jazz in the neck position, it's got a maple neck and alder body in neck-thru design, ebony fretboard with 24 frets. I don't recall ever being able to find much on Pekka's guitar though.
Amp wise, they used Line 6 AX212s for the first 3 albums and used Peavey JSXs through Laney cabs on The Black Waltz. Not sure what they've used since then but I think I read something about them switching to Krank amps, no idea what model though.
